Welcome aboard! Quick handover on Larkspur's config hot-reload: the watcher picks up changes to the quota and routing files within ten seconds, but schema errors roll back silently, so always check the reload log after edits. Never hot-reload the TLS block — that needs a restart. Full procedure is documented internally here:

runbook for badug-kadup: https://confluence.zemvarlabs.internal/projects/browse/display/projects/bd1b

**TICKET-4471: Watchdog rejects plugin — signature check failed**

The Maribel kiosk watchdog refuses plugins signed with the retired March key. Affected authors: re-sign your bundles and resubmit. Old signatures fail validation at watchdog restart, forcing safe mode. No code changes needed, just re-signing. Sign against the current watchdog trust key, listed below.

rollout seal: bky9_PeXH1fTLY

Action item (owner: release eng): the Pellwick metrics-aggregation sidecar flushed under memory pressure during the Q3 incident, dropping ~4% of gauges before the rollout to the Harlowe cluster completed. We agreed to pin flush intervals and buffer sizes in the release manifest rather than relying on defaults. The agreed tuning constants for the next release are listed below.

tuning table, faduf-baduf:
PRIORITIES = {
    "ulavan": 191,
    "silys": 750,
    "goriel": 238,
    "kelmir": 66,
    "wendor": 432,
}

# Eastvale Expansion — Managers Only

Quick update for the board pack: Torrel Foods is moving ahead with the Eastvale region launch. We've signed the Danmoor warehouse lease, and recruitment for the regional team kicks off next month. Early retailer chats have been promising — three chains want pilot stock of the Greenholt line by spring. Marketing spend stays modest until sell-through data lands. The bit we're keeping off the main wiki is appended just below.

management briefing: The renewal with Quenaelox Group closes at $2 million a year, 15 percent below the last contract. Project Holwyn slips by six weeks because of the tooling delay.